What Is the Android Security Bulletin?
The Android Security Bulletin is a monthly publication by Google that outlines security vulnerabilities affecting Android devices. It provides detailed information about each issue, including its severity, affected components, and the necessary patches. The June 2025 bulletin highlights 34 high-severity vulnerabilities, with the most critical being a flaw in the System component that could allow local escalation of privilege without additional execution privileges. This vulnerability requires user interaction, making timely updates essential to prevent exploitation.

Critical System Component Vulnerability
The most severe issue in the June 2025 update is a high-severity vulnerability in the Android System component. This flaw could enable a local attacker to escalate privileges without needing additional execution rights, potentially granting unauthorized access to sensitive device functions. While user interaction is required, the risk remains significant if mitigations like Google Play Protect are disabled or bypassed. Google has rated this vulnerability based on its potential impact, assuming platform protections are off, emphasizing the importance of keeping devices updated.
Other High-Severity Vulnerabilities
The update addresses 33 additional high-severity vulnerabilities across various Android components, including the Android Framework and proprietary elements. These flaws could lead to outcomes like remote code execution, information disclosure, or denial of service. For instance, a vulnerability in the FreeType library, used in over a billion devices for font rendering, was patched in May 2025 after being actively exploited since March. The June update continues Google’s proactive approach to securing the Android ecosystem.
Project Mainline Components
Several vulnerabilities fall under Project Mainline, which modularizes core Android components like media codecs and DNS resolvers. Introduced in Android 10, Project Mainline allows Google to deliver updates directly via Google Play, bypassing the need for full OS updates. This ensures faster and more uniform patch deployment across the Android ecosystem, reducing the window of vulnerability for users.

Google Play Protect: A First Line of Defense
Google Play Protect is a built-in security feature on devices with Google Mobile Services, actively scanning for malicious apps and behaviors. Enabled by default, it significantly reduces the likelihood of successful exploits, even for high-severity vulnerabilities. For users installing apps outside Google Play, Play Protect is particularly crucial, as it warns against Potentially Harmful Applications (PHAs). The June 2025 update enhances these protections, ensuring robust defense against the identified vulnerabilities.
Collaboration with the Android Ecosystem
Google collaborates with device manufacturers, security researchers, and the broader Android community to identify and mitigate vulnerabilities. The Android Security Team sources bugs from internal research, third-party reports, academic studies, and public disclosures on platforms like X. This collaborative approach ensures comprehensive vulnerability management. Android partners are notified of issues at least a month before bulletin publication, allowing time for OEMs to prepare device-specific patches.
The Role of AOSP in Security
The Android Open Source Project (AOSP) is central to Google’s security strategy. Once patches are developed, they are released to the AOSP repository, enabling manufacturers to integrate them into device updates. For the June 2025 bulletin, Google will release source code patches within 48 hours, ensuring transparency and accessibility for developers. This open-source model fosters rapid patch deployment but can face delays due to OEM and carrier customizations.

Checking Your Device’s Security Patch Level
To ensure your device is protected, check its security patch level by navigating to Settings > About Phone > Android Version. If your device’s patch level is earlier than 2025-06-05, update it immediately. Google provides detailed instructions on its support page for checking and updating Android versions. Regular updates are critical, as vulnerabilities like those in the June 2025 bulletin can be exploited if left unpatched.
Enabling Automatic Updates
Most Android devices support automatic security updates, which install patches as soon as they’re available. To enable this, go to Settings > System > System Update and ensure automatic updates are turned on. Challenges in the Android Ecosystem
The AOSP ecosystem’s complexity, involving multiple manufacturers and carriers, can delay updates. For instance, OEM customizations may conflict with AOSP patches, causing delays or skipped updates.
